Patent number: 7909071Abstract: A method for the contamination-preventing transferring bulk material between a container having a flexible opening and a connecting tube using a tubular film is placed around the connecting tube; the tubular film is tied beyond the connecting tube leaving a free end of the tubular film beyond the tying point; the flexible opening and the tubular film are connected; the tying points of the outlet and the tubular film are untied, and the bulk material transferred; the free end of the tubular film, is constricted and additional tubular film is pulled from a tubular film supply until clean tubular film is available beyond the connecting tube; the tubular film is closed at two points in the clean section and cut in two between them; additional tubular film is pulled from the tubular film supply, and tied at a tying point located at a distance from the cutting point.Type: GrantFiled: December 10, 2004Date of Patent: March 22, 2011Assignee: Hecht Anlagenbau GmbHInventors: Richard Denk, Manfred Helmer, Timothey Rocholl

Patent number: 7634896Abstract: A liner emptying device and a liner filling device as well as methods using them for contamination-free filling and emptying of a liner. This contamination-free filling and emptying prevents any danger to the health of the people working with the packaged substances. Both the liner emptying device and the liner filling device are connected to the liner via a fastening device and the residual films sealing off the device can be removed via an access port, whereby the liner can be filled or emptied without contaminating the surroundings.Type: GrantFiled: December 4, 2007Date of Patent: December 22, 2009Assignee: Hecht Anlagenbau GmbHInventors: Steven Multer, Karsten Weber

Publication number: 20090297329Abstract: A method for operating a package emptying station having a work station, in which an emptying step is performed, an inlet via which the package to be emptied is inserted into the work station, an outlet via which the emptied package is ejected, and a product outlet through which the emptied contents of the package is discharged. Continuous tubular film packs are provided both at the inlet and also at the package outlet which seal off the inlet and the outlet and encase the package to be emptied or the emptied package during the insertion or corresponding ejection of the package. The film is sealed off and severed between individual packages such that the interior and the exterior do not come into contact. In this manner, both contamination of the package contents by environmental substances and also any contamination of the environment by the package contents can be avoided.Type: ApplicationFiled: August 10, 2009Publication date: December 3, 2009Applicant: HECHT ANLAGENBAU GMBHInventors: Timothy Rocholl, Jan Hecht

Publication number: 20020108673Abstract: Trickling safeguard for a filling station used to fill containers with bulk material, the filling station having a fill tube through which the bulk material flows into the container. The safeguard includes a two-part flap whose dimensions at least match those of the interior cross section of the fill tube and is arranged transverse to the length of the fill tube at the end thereof. The flap parts are pivotable about a shaft so as to lie in the direction of the bulk material stream.Type: ApplicationFiled: February 14, 2002Publication date: August 15, 2002Applicant: Hecht Anlagenbau GmbhInventor: Gunther Hecht
